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Newspaper Imports.

asked the Minister for Industry and Commerce if he proposes to take any steps to reduce the imports from England of newspapers and other reading matter which are at present coming into the Republic of Ireland free of duty.

The volume of imports of newspapers and other reading matter is under examination, but I am not in a position to say at present what steps, if any, are practicable in the matter.

Will the Minister say how long they are under consideration?

I could not say exactly, but I know that a subject matter such as this is under consideration from time to time.
